khalood بتاريخ: 13 يوليو 2005 تقديم بلاغ مشاركة بتاريخ: 13 يوليو 2005 ما هو ال pragma من حيث المعنى و ما هى استخداماتها و شكرا لإهتمامكم ا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
MoonWalker_NASA بتاريخ: 14 سبتمبر 2005 تقديم بلاغ مشاركة بتاريخ: 14 سبتمبر 2005 هناك Exception كثيرة فى ال oracle وكل Execption له أسم ورقم ...,أحيانا لا يظهر اسم الخطأ صراحتا ولكن كل ما يهمنا رقم ال Exceptionولعمل handling لهذا الخطأ نستخدم رقمة ونربطه بما يسمي ال pragmaوكيف يستخدم ؟أولا : نعمل متغير من نوع Exception ثانيا : نأخد رقم Exception ونربطة مع ال Pragmaنأخذ مثال :ُ Declare E Exception; // Exception هنا صرحنا بمتغير من نوع Pragma exception_init(E , - 01422); exception وهنا ربطنا البراجما برقم الخطأ ونمرر له اسم المتغير من نوع // X Number; Begin select * into x from emp; //this statement will make exception Exception when E then DBMS_OUTPUT.PUT_LINE('NO WAY TO RETREIVE DATA ...'); END; ا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
Recommended Posts
انضم إلى المناقشة
ي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.